WARRNAMBOOL residents will have an equal opportunity to immortalise deceased loved ones in the naming of new streets under a city council proposal.
The plan will allow anyone to nominate a prospective street name for a city-wide list, which developers of subdivisions will be restricted to choosing from.
[snip]
[CEO Lindsay Merritt said] "For example, a subdivider could own some land that he or she wants to develop. In theory, someone could bob up whose great, great grandfather owned it in another lifetime and put forward a really relevant street name that has historical significance."
